What kinds of surfaces can Liquid Vinyl Siding be applied on?

0

A. Liquid Vinyl Siding can be applied to virtually any unpainted, painted, or stained surfaces including wood, hardie plank, Masonite, composite board siding, vinyl and aluminum siding, stucco, masonry, brick block, and certain metal surfaces. Liquid Vinyl Siding is not recommended for roofs and surfaces that one might walk on, such as decks; however, we can coat railings, porch ceilings, lattice, and columns.
